    Don't let appearances deceive you. The corner of La Brea & Sunset isn't the poshest neighborhood, but this spacious establishment located on the 2nd floor of a fading strip center is actually a good spot. You have the options of taking the stairs or a sketchy elevator only a serial killer could love. I paid $50 + Tip for a 60-minute Foot Reflexology in the open area main room. This is about $20 more than I pay for a similar experience back home in Houston, TX. After a relaxing, warm foot bath I settled in for a thorough foot and leg massage -- with the perfect pressure. I've never had so much focused attention on my toes! Apparently my calf muscles were really tight too. If you're a tourist weary from sightseeing or a local looking for a good spot to relax - check them out! Bonus: there's a Starbuck's and a really good little spot Thai restaurant called WeHo located across the street.

    Stephen P.

    3.5 stars extra for a clean, tidy interior. Rounded up. Nice to see a Chinese foot spa pop up near my hood - and with that you get the competitive pricing. It's a pretty large place with ~20 seats, but when I went one sunny weekend it wasn't too busy. Don't be put off by the store frontage or unappealing strip mall setting. My guy did a pretty good job - started with soaking feet, back massage and then the reflexology. Wear loose legged pants so you can roll them up comfortably. I'd go back, but I tend to find I can get to all the aches better than paying someone, but this Living Social deal was a good way to try something new.
